Output e51b24ab4460aba66b611611d3e7b0676a03e13c7f144607ac7db5854ead1e48:5

value
866193
script pubkey
OP_0 OP_PUSHBYTES_20 353f81955190e727b183338a74b7448d625d7d91
address
bc1qx5lcr923jrnj0vvrxw98fd6y34396lv3pk6uke
transaction
e51b24ab4460aba66b611611d3e7b0676a03e13c7f144607ac7db5854ead1e48